  abstract = "<p>Automatic extraction of synonyms and/or semantically related 
              words has various applications in Natural Language Processing (NLP).
              There are currently two mainstream extraction paradigms, namely,
              lexicon-based and distributional approaches. The former usually suffers 
              from low coverage, while the latter is only able to capture general
              relatedness rather than strict synonymy.</p>
              <p>
              In this paper, two rule-based extraction methods are applied to
              denitions from a machine-readable dictionary. Extracted synonyms
              are evaluated in two experiments by solving TOEFL synonym questions
              and being compared against existing thesauri. The proposed approaches
              have achieved satisfactory results in both evaluations, comparable
              to published studies or even the state of the art.
              </p>",
